One trip, three decisions

1 · Pack

Potions, food, ammunition and empty space. Weight and bag slots are a two-sided limit: together they decide how many hours the trip lasts before your character turns for home.

2 · Hunt

Pick a spot and go. Your character fights alone for hours, and the trip is settled on the server - the outcome is the same whether you watched every swing or slept through it.

3 · Settle

Loot is sold, supplies are counted and the ledger closes: exp per hour, profit per hour, what it cost and how close it came to going wrong. Then you plan the next one.

Six lands, one road down

Each land is a tier of monsters, gear, materials and prices. The road from the first meadow to the Abyss is the whole game - the lands page has every spot.

What opens when

Levels are the only gate that matters for systems. Content gates - which dungeon, which spot, which recipe - come from tiers, and a tier is 25 levels wide.

  • L1Your first hunting spot, the town shop and the backpack you were given
  • L10Rankings - characters compared by level, skills and gold
  • L15Auction house - players start setting prices above the shop floor
  • L25Guilds - perks, member trade and raid bosses
  • L26Tier 2 gear, tier 2 materials and the second land
  • L26The Descent - dungeons run with hired mercenaries
  • L51Tier 3, where the jungle and the mid-game economy start
  • L76Tier 4 - crafting deepens, and purses start coming home in 100 gp ducats
  • L101Tier 5 - the Castle, and the hardest open-world spots
  • L126Tier 6 - the Abyss and the end of the road down

How to read these pages

  • Levels are the character level a thing is built around. Gear also has an equip level, which is the first level of its tier - a tier 3 sword is worn from L51 up.
  • Weight is in ounces (oz). It is the real currency of a trip: your class and your backpack set the ceiling, and everything you carry - including coins - spends it.
  • Prices in gp are the town shop floor. Players trade above that floor in the auction house, and that is where a good drop is actually worth something.
  • Chances are per kill unless the page says otherwise.
